1. Go Paperless

An easy way to rid yourself of the huge paper mess caused by monthly bills, magazines, and the like is to go paperless. Enroll in paperless statements for all of your bills and bank statements, and download a free scanner app for your smartphone such as Evernote to digitally store tax returns, insurance policies, and other important documents.

2. Maximize Closet Space with Under-bed Storage

Make the most of the space in your walk-in closet by removing your out-of-season wardrobe and storing it in rolling containers under your bed. This will make it extremely easy to find what you want to wear and will give your closet the appearance of a high-end clothing boutique rather than an overwhelming mess of clothes.

3. Use Multipurpose Furniture

You can never have too much seating in your apartment home, especially if you like entertaining guests. Consider using some storage ottomans that can also double as seating. This extra storage space is ideal for quickly tucking away blankets, pillows, remote controls, or any other trinkets around your apartment home.

4. Define Your Space with Tall Bookshelves

If you live in a studio apartment or simply want to divide up the space in your apartment home, use some tall bookshelves like these affordable Billy bookshelves from Ikea. Bookshelves will help define the space in your apartment home and provide additional storage space for books, pictures, artwork, collections, and more.

5. Create Vertical Storage on Walls and Doors

There are many options online for stylish hanging baskets that offer storage and create a point of interest on walls and doors. Some other easy solutions include Command hooks for belts, coats, and more, and over-the-door shoe organizers, which are great for storing makeup and toiletries.
